disinclined

IPA: /ˌdɪsɪnˈklaɪnd/

KK: /dɪsɪnˈklaɪnd/

adjective

Definition: Not wanting to do something or feeling reluctant about it.

Example: She was disinclined to join the party because she preferred to stay home.

disinfect

IPA: //ˌdɪsɪnˈfɛkt//

KK: /dɪsɪnˈfɛkt/

transitive verb

Definition: To clean something in order to kill or stop the growth of germs and bacteria that can cause disease.

Example: It is important to disinfect surfaces in the kitchen to keep them safe from germs.

disinfectant

IPA: //ˌdɪsɪnˈfɛktənt//

KK: /ˌdɪsɪnˈfɛktənt/

adjective

Definition: A substance that is used to kill germs and bacteria on surfaces or in the air.

Example: The hospital uses a strong disinfectant to keep the environment clean and safe.

noun

Definition: A substance used to kill germs and bacteria on surfaces to prevent infection.

Example: The hospital uses a strong disinfectant to clean the operating rooms.

disinfection

IPA: /ˌdɪsɪnˈfɛkʃən/

KK: /dɪsɪnˈfɛkʃən/

noun

Definition: The process of using special substances to kill germs and bacteria on surfaces or in the air to make them safe and clean.

Example: The hospital uses disinfection to ensure that all equipment is free from harmful germs.

disinfest

IPA: /ˌdɪsɪnˈfɛst/

KK: /dɪsɪnˈfɛst/

transitive verb

Definition: To remove pests or vermin from a place or object.

Example: The exterminator was called to disinfest the house of termites.

disinfestation

IPA: /ˌdɪsɪnˈfɛsteɪʃən/

KK: /dɪsɪnˈfɛsteɪʃən/

noun

Definition: The process of removing pests or vermin from a place.

Example: The disinfestation of the old house was necessary to make it safe for living.

disinflation

IPA: /dɪsɪnˈfleɪʃən/

KK: /dɪsɪnˈfleɪʃən/

noun

Definition: A decrease in the rate of inflation, meaning that prices are still rising but at a slower pace than before.

Example: The government implemented policies to encourage disinflation in the economy.

disinflationary

IPA: /ˌdɪsɪnˈfleɪʃənəri/

KK: /dɪsɪnˈfleɪʃənɛri/

adjective

Definition: Describing a situation or policy that leads to a decrease in the rate of inflation, meaning prices are rising more slowly than before.

Example: The government implemented disinflationary measures to stabilize the economy.

disinformation

IPA: /ˌdɪsɪnfəˈmeɪʃən/

KK: /dɪsˌɪnfərˈmeɪʃən/

noun

Definition: False information that is spread intentionally to mislead people, often to influence opinions or hide the truth.

Example: The campaign was filled with disinformation aimed at confusing voters.

disingenuous

IPA: //dɪsɪnˈdʒɛnjʊəs//

KK: /dɪsɪnˈdʒɛnjuəs/

adjective

Definition: Not being honest or sincere; pretending to be innocent or unaware while actually being manipulative or calculating.

Example: His disingenuous remarks made it clear that he was not being truthful.
